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Mitigation

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a musty smell in your home that won’t go away, it could be a sign of water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the odor and recommend the best course of action to remove it.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the stain and recommend the best course of action to repair it.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and recommend the best course of action to repair it.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and recommend the best course of action to repair it.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Mold or mildew growth can be a sign of water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and recommend the best course of action to remove it.

Water Damage Mitigation v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ak under the sink Yes No You can likely fix it yourself with a wrench and some basic plumbing knowledge.
Roof leak after a storm No Yes You’ll need specialized equipment and expertise to safely and effectively repair the damage.
Water damage from a burst pipe No Yes You’ll need to act quickly to prevent further damage and reduce the risk of mold growth.
Water damage from a flooded basement No Yes You’ll need specialized equipment and expertise to safely and effectively extract the water and dry the area.

While some water damage situations may seem like they can be handled DIY, it’s often better to err on the side of caution and call a professional. Water damage can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and even structural damage to your home. Water Damage Mitigation Cost In Forney, TX

The cost of water damage mitigation in Forney, TX,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of flooring, and equ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and duration of treatment
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of surfaces, and level of contamination

Common Questions About Water Damage Mitigation

Q: What causes water damage in my home?

A: Water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including roof leaks, burst pipes, flooding, and appliance malfunctions. Our team can help you identify the source of the damage and recommend the best course of action to prevent it from happening again.

Q: How long does it take to dry out my home after water damage?

A: The length of time it takes to dry out your home after water damage depends on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ions.
